Academy Osc Martial Arts & Fitness
Closed
448 Tanglewood Dr
Davenport, FL 33896
Osc Martial Arts is a reputable martial arts studio situated in Davenport, FL. They offer a variety of classes focused on self-defense techniques and physical fitness.
With experienced instructors, Osc Martial Arts provides a welcoming environment for individuals of all skill levels to enhance their martial arts skills and improve their overall well-being.
Generated from their business information
See a problem?